In Loving Memory of Torrey Mund

Torrey Thadd Mund, 56, of Stockbridge, Georgia, passed away on Sunday,

April 30, 2017.

He was born in Seoul, Korea on March 30, 1961 and adopted by Andrew and Margaret Mund of Gulf Shores, Alabama on March 26, 1969. His childhood was spent around the water as he learned hard work ethics through the commercial fishing industry from his father.

After graduating from Central Christian School in Robertsdale, Alabama, he attended Bible college in Georgia, fulfilling his desire to be trained for Christian service.

Torrey always strived to be a Christian witness to everyone he met. His last employment was with the Clayton County Water Authority where he worked for nearly eight years as Distribution and Conveyance Equipment Operator. It was said of Torrey, once you met him, you never forgot his smile. Torrey brought years of experience and knowledge to CCWA from his many years of work with the City of Riverdale's water department.

Torrey's employers said of him, "Torrey was a dedicated employee who always managed to go above and beyond the call of duty." He was known as a kind and caring individual with a great sense of humor. "In this line of work often times a job can become a difficult challenge testing everyone's patience and stamina," says Crew Leader Scott Cantrell. "Having Torrey on the crew always helped us get through the difficult times, as he always maintained a positive attitude, encouraged his coworkers, and gave his all to complete the job at hand."

During a doctor's visit earlier this year, it was discovered that Torrey had a terminal illness. Despite receiving the terrible diagnosis of cancer, Torrey managed to keep a positive attitude and fought hard until he went to be with his Lord and Savior on April 30th. It was abundantly evident at Torrey's funeral all the friends he had made as the funeral home's porches, large halls, parlor and chapel were completely filled and others had to be turned away. The support and love felt for Torrey there was overwhelming as many shared how he had touched their lives and would be greatly missed.

Torrey was preceded in death by his father, Andrew Mund; and survived by his wife, Teresa Mund; his stepson, Joshua Sells (Maddie) of LaGrange; his stepdaughter, Lisa O'Connor (Troy) of Monroe; nine step-grandchildren; his mother, Margaret Mund; his sisters, Janna Mund Lanier (Matthew Demers), Malinda Arnould (Stephen); his brothers, Dr. Wayne Mund (Lenora) and Mark Mund (Beth), all of Gulf Shores, Alabama; and numerous nieces and nephews.
